Summary

Caden Moss, a four-star offensive lineman, has committed to Ohio State, selecting them over Oregon, LSU, and others. The announcement came on June 27, 2026. Previously, Moss was expected to choose Ole Miss but shifted his decision to the Buckeyes late in the recruitment process. Oregon, while missing out on Moss, has secured other commitments, including three-star offensive lineman Lex Mailangi. The Ducks currently rank ninth nationally for recruitment according to Rivals.

  • Caden Moss is 6-foot-5, 320 pounds and plays left tackle.
  • Moss is the top-ranked player from Mississippi.
  • Oregon has added four offensive linemen to their recruiting class.
  • Lex Mailangi recently committed to Oregon, bolstering their offensive line.
  • Oregon's 2027 class is ranked fifth by 247 Sports.
